Gardner, John Glenn Jr. {I3750} (b. 10 NOV 1933, d. 31 AUG 2005)
Note: Wednesday, August 31, 2005, The Winchester Star
John G. Gardner Jr.
John Glenn Gardner Jr., 71, of Berryville, died Monday, Aug. 29, 2005, in a local nursing
home.
Mr. Gardner was born Nov. 10, 1933, in Rippon, W.Va., the son of John Glenn and
Elfrieda Jenkins Gardner. He was retired from the Federal Emergency Management
Agency.
He was a graduate of Shepherd College and a Navy veteran of the Korean War.
He was a member of Grace Episcopal Church, Charles Town Moose Lodge, Winchester
Eagles, and Berryville VFW Post 9760.
Surviving are a son, John G. Gardner III of Dickson, Term.; two daughters, Leslie
Gardner Kelley of Round Hill and Karen Gardner Johnson of Berryville; three sisters,
Gloria Jones of Berryville, June Baxter of Frederick, Md., and Geraldine Thompson of
Panama City, Fla.; and a grandchild.
Two sisters, Betty Lee and Mary Bauserman, are deceased.
A graveside service will be at 11 a.m. Thursday at Green Hill Cemetery, Berryville, with
the Very Rev. Canon Dwight L. Brown officiating. Military honors will be accorded by
Clarke County Honor Guard.
Memorials may be made to Clarke County Humane Foundation, P.O. Box 713, Enders &
Shirley Funeral Home, Berryville, 22611.
